I think you'll love the Disneyland Hotel, it's not really like anything at WDW, but it has its own historical Disney charm. If you're exploring the hotel, check out the displays they have in the Fantasy tower...lots of cool Disney memorabilia! Also the Frontier Tower has a miniature version of Big Thunder that is pretty awesome. I love the grounds and just relaxing by the pool. It feels so tropical!

If you're an early riser, you'll find you can do so much in the first few hours of the parks at DLR. Since it's more of a locals park, as the day goes on you'll notice the crowds pick up, especially after work hours. And our quick service is actually really good with lots of fresh options.
